Displaying 1 result from an estimated 1 matches for "ee44c56".
2011 Apr 07
3
Re: xen: do not create the extra e820 region at an addr lower than 4G
...es; i++) {
unsigned long long end;
"(1UL<<32)" will overflow on a 32 bit kernel.
Oh hang on... that''s the difference between the -rc1 and -rc2 versions
of Stefano''s branches:
diff --git a/arch/x86/xen/setup.c b/arch/x86/xen/setup.c
index f831568..ee44c56 100644
--- a/arch/x86/xen/setup.c
+++ b/arch/x86/xen/setup.c
@@ -229,7 +229,7 @@ char * __init xen_memory_setup(void)
memcpy(map_raw, map, sizeof(map));
e820.nr_map = 0;
- xen_extra_mem_start = mem_end < (1UL<<32) ? (1UL<<32) : mem_end;
+ xen_extra_mem_s...